Standard forklifts have a low chassis and are typically only suitable for working on flat, even surfaces. They feature rear-wheel drive, small standard tires, and average grip. In contrast, rough terrain forklifts are four-wheel drive with a higher chassis than standard forklifts, offering better passability on uneven ground and preventing chassis impacts. Rough terrain forklifts are larger in size and equipped with high-horsepower engines, delivering strong power. When operating on rugged roads such as mountain trails or muddy paths, their off-road tires provide strong grip and are less prone to slipping.
An anti-skid forklift tire with high load-bearing capacity and excellent ground contact performance should be fitted. The front wheels use a four-axle support structure for the tires, enhancing front-wheel rigidity while making disassembly easy for convenient maintenance. The tread pattern is optimized through design, with each pattern unit composed of straight and angled grooves that form a "7"-shaped tread pattern, enhancing edge friction and ensuring traction during driving. Circumferentially adjacent tread grooves create unobstructed ground contact channels, improving ground contact performance even when pattern units undergo plastic deformation. The angled grooves connect the heads of alternately adjacent straight grooves, integrating the tread groove system as a whole, strengthening tread rigidity and thereby extending tire service life.
